According to Teelie and Tahsakkori (2009), what is a 'sequential' mixed methods design?

a. each method is carried out simultaneously
b. questions and/or procedures from one method depend on the prior method and may evolve as the study unfolds
c. data is first used for qualitative analysis, then the same data is used for quantitative analysis to answer the same question
d. quantitative data collection occurs after the study team receives ethics approval


Ans: b
